LINK Centre for Deafened People

Other or former names: Challenging Deafness programme

Description

National UK organisation for deafened men and women and their families - people who have grown up with normal or near-normal hearing, then become severely or totally deaf in adult life.

It offers specialist rehabilitation for deafened people. It helps people adjust to deafness in everyday living through rehabilitation and life skills programmes, training health care professionals in acquired deafness, and conducting research that will advance the understanding of this type of deafness.

It also has an Outreach Volunteer scheme has Challenging Deafness programmes, Social support groups, cochlear implant support programmes.
